29 lines
1.4 KiB
HTML
29 lines
1.4 KiB
HTML
|
|
{%- set style_bg_color = page.extra.style.bg_color |
|
||
|
|
default(value=(section.extra.style.bg_color |
|
||
|
|
default(value=(config.extra.style.bg_color |
|
||
|
|
default(value="#f4f4f5"))))) %}
|
||
|
|
{%- set style_bg_dark_color = page.extra.style.bg_dark_color |
|
||
|
|
default(value=(section.extra.style.bg_dark_color |
|
||
|
|
default(value=(config.extra.style.bg_dark_color |
|
||
|
|
default(value="#18181b"))))) %}
|
||
|
|
{%- set style_header_color = page.extra.style.header_color |
|
||
|
|
default(value=(section.extra.style.header_color |
|
||
|
|
default(value=(config.extra.style.header_color |
|
||
|
|
default(value="#e4e4e7"))))) %}
|
||
|
|
{%- set style_header_dark_color = page.extra.style.header_dark_color |
|
||
|
|
default(value=(section.extra.style.header_dark_color |
|
||
|
|
default(value=(config.extra.style.header_dark_color |
|
||
|
|
default(value="#27272a"))))) %}
|
||
|
|
<style>
|
||
|
|
:root{--bg: {{ style_bg_color | escape_xml | safe
|
||
|
|
}}; --header: {{ style_header_color | escape_xml | safe
|
||
|
|
}}; color-scheme: light;}
|
||
|
|
:root.dark{--bg: {{ style_bg_dark_color | escape_xml | safe
|
||
|
|
}}; --header: {{ style_header_dark_color | escape_xml | safe
|
||
|
|
}}; color-scheme: dark;}
|
||
|
|
</style>
|
||
|
|
{%- if not config.extra.style.header_blur %}
|
||
|
|
<meta name="theme-color" data-light="{{ style_header_color | escape_xml | safe }}" data-dark="{{
|
||
|
|
style_header_dark_color | escape_xml | safe }}" content="{{ style_header_color | escape_xml | safe }}" />
|
||
|
|
{%- endif -%}
|